    世界设施园艺智能化装备发展对中国的启示研究

    Development of intelligent equipment for protected horticulture in world and enlightenment to China

    • 摘要: 设施园艺智能化是实现园艺产品播种移栽、栽培管理、环境调控、监测预警、作物采收、内部物流等全过程数字化、精细化、自主化的高级生产形态,是当前包括中国在内的世界农业智能化装备的研发热点和产业升级重点。为在全球设施园艺智能化装备发展的大格局下科学定位中国的发展路径,指导中国设施园艺智能化装备的研发和推广,需要对世界各国在该领域的发展现状和趋势进行研究分析。该文以全球设施园艺领域个人、企业和科研机构在智能化方面的主要研究内容和装备开发重点为基础,从全产业链的角度,分析世界设施园艺智能化装备的发展现状。籽种生产在播种、移栽等环节上已初步实现了智能化应用;作物生产在植株调整、授粉、植保和收获等环节正加快研发,剪叶、巡检等部分智能化装备已经进入商业化试用;仓储物流在内部运输、分级分选、清洗、包装等智能化方面不断完善,智能苗床输送、运输机器人已大量应用,高速分选、包装机器人等在加快研发。分析发现,世界设施园艺智能化装备需求增长快、研发方向逐步聚焦、更加注重绿色安全、单机商业化速度加快、系统集成的全智能化生产设施开始出现。研究分析成果对中国设施园艺智能化的科技战略和产业政策制订、科研立项、成果评价、国际合作、装备研发及推广等工作提供参考和借鉴。

       

      Abstract: Intelligent protected horticulture is the advanced production form of digitization, refinement and automation in the whole process of horticultural products seeding and transplanting, cultivation management, environmental controlling, monitoring and early warning, harvesting and inner logistic etc. It is the hotspot of research and development and also the focus of agriculture upgrading both in China and overseas. In order to locate the development path of China and guide the research and development of the intelligent equipment of Chinese protected horticulture, it is necessary to study and analyze the current status and trend of the world's development in this field. Based on the individuals’, enterprises’ and institutes’ main research in intelligent technology and equipment, the status and prospect of theintelligent equipment are analyzed. Intelligent seed production has been preliminarily realized in sowing and transplanting. The development of intelligent crop production in the aspects of plant adjustment, pollination, plant protection and harvest is speeding up. Some intelligent equipment such as leaf cutting and inspection has entered commercialized trial. Intelligent storage logistics has been continuously improved continuously in internal transportation, classification separation, cleaning, packaging and so on. The intelligent seedbed conveying and transportation robot has been widely applied, and research for high-speed sorting and packaging robots are accelerating research and development. It is found that the demand for intelligent equipment in the world protected horticulture is growing rapidly, the direction of research and development is gradually focused, green and safety are concerned more, commercialization of single machine is accelerating, and the systematic integrated intelligent production facilities are beginning to emerge.The research and analysis results have important reference for the scientific and technological strategy and industrial policy formulation, scientific research projectapproval, achievement evaluation, international cooperation and equipment research and development forintelligent protected horticulture in China.
